## Idempotency Keys for Payment Retries (Lumopay)

Every retry of a charge request must reuse the original idempotency key; generating a new key on retry can produce duplicate charges. Keys are scoped per merchant and expire after 48 hours. Reviewers should verify keys are derived server-side, never from client input. The full key-generation specification and threat model are maintained on the internal page.

dashboard of kaguf-tawip = https://vault.merlaqsys.test/issue

**Studio 4 — Training Video Recordings**

Studio 4 (second floor, Kestrel Wing) is bookable via the facilities desk only. No food, no hot drinks, lights off on exit. Bookings under two hours get priority. The door locks automatically; facilities staff admit presenters at the start of each session using the keypad code below.

door code, kawip-bagap: bdg-HQEWH-4

# Break-Glass: Catalog Cache Invalidation

Scope: the Pinrow product catalog at Veldstone Retail. If stale prices persist after a purge and the Hollowmere invalidation queue is wedged, use break-glass to flush the edge tier directly. Contractors: get verbal sign-off from the catalog lead first. Steps: open the Hollowmere admin shell, select emergency-flush, confirm the tenant, and run it once — repeated flushes thrash the origin. Access is logged and expires after 20 minutes. Unseal the admin shell with the passphrase below.

recovery phrase for kahop-tajog: istix-casvan